Montco Is Throwing a Free 5-Day World Cup Fan Festival at King of Prussia Mall. Here’s Everything You Need to Know.

The Montco Watch Party at King of Prussia Mall promises the kind of communal excitement soccer fans live for — free, outdoors, and open to everyone June 30 through July 4.

You don’t need a ticket to one of Philadelphia’s World Cup matches to be part of the excitement this summer.

Starting Monday, June 30, the parking lot outside King of Prussia Mall transforms into one of the region’s biggest free public gatherings of the World Cup era: the Montco Watch Party, a five-day outdoor fan festival running through July 4.

Up to 1,000 soccer fans per match can watch the tournament live on giant video screens, dig into food truck fare, and soak up the kind of communal sports energy that only comes around once in a generation.

Admission is free. All you need is a reservation.

What It Is

The Montco Watch Party sets up in the mall parking lot adjacent to True Food Kitchen and runs June 30 through July 4, with two matches broadcast each day on large outdoor screens.

Organizers cap attendance at 1,000 guests per match, and advance registration is required, so if you’re planning to go, don’t wait.

This isn’t just a place to watch soccer. The event is designed as a full fan festival, with live DJs spinning before and between matches, food and beverage trucks on site throughout the day, and a dedicated kids’ area featuring soccer activities led by Eastern Pennsylvania Youth Soccer and face painting.

The Highlight of the Week

Mark Thursday, July 2 on your calendar. After the evening match wraps up, a free drone light show set to music by DeeJay Shelly is scheduled to light up the sky above King of Prussia.

It’s the kind of add-on that turns a watch party into a genuine summer memory.

Why July 4 Is the Big Finale

The festival closes on Independence Day with extra reason to celebrate.

A quarterfinal match is being played at Lincoln Financial Field in Philadelphia that day, meaning the Montco Watch Party crowd will be watching history unfold in real time, just a few miles from where it’s happening.

Getting There

Driving is easy. The mall offers free parking for the event.

But organizers are also making it simple to leave the car at home: a complimentary shuttle runs continuously from June 30 through July 4 between the Conshohocken SEPTA station, King of Prussia Mall, and Valley Forge National Historical Park.

Rideshare passengers can be dropped off near Eataly.

What to Bring, What to Leave Home

Guests are encouraged to bring lawn chairs or blankets for designated seating areas.

One factory-sealed, one-liter water bottle per person is allowed inside.

Everything else, outside food, alcohol, coolers, and large bags, stays outside.

All food and beverage purchases on site are cashless, and food trucks will be operating throughout each day.

One More Perk

Everyone who registers for the watch party is eligible for a complimentary gift from the King of Prussia Mall Concierge on Level 2, available while supplies last.

Just show your event registration when you stop by.
